Real-Time Stream Processing Engineer (Flink & Kafka)

Real-Time Stream Processing Engineer (Flink & Kafka)

Full-Time 87500 - 87500 £ / year (est.) No working from home possible
hackajob

At a Glance

  • Tasks: Design and implement real-time stream processing systems using Flink and Kafka.
  • Company: Join hackajob, a forward-thinking tech company focused on innovation.
  • Benefits: Starting salary of £87,500 plus RSUs and great perks.
  • Other info: Exciting opportunity to work with AWS and complex distributed systems.
  • Why this job: Be at the forefront of technology and make an impact in stream processing.
  • Qualifications: Expertise in Flink, Kafka, Java, and Spring required.

The predicted salary is between 87500 - 87500 £ per year.

hackajob is seeking a senior software engineer with experience in stream processing to work on their AWS systems. The role involves designing, architecting, implementing, and operating systems, while also assisting Product Engineers with tooling.

The ideal candidate should have expertise in Apache Flink, Kafka Streams, and a strong background in Java and Spring, alongside the capacity to build and manage complex distributed systems. Salary starts at £87,500 with additional RSUs.

Real-Time Stream Processing Engineer (Flink & Kafka) employer: hackajob

At hackajob, we pride ourselves on fostering a dynamic and innovative work culture that empowers our employees to excel in their roles. As a Real-Time Stream Processing Engineer, you will not only enjoy a competitive salary starting at £87,500 and additional RSUs, but also benefit from continuous professional development opportunities and a collaborative environment that encourages creativity and growth. Located in a vibrant tech hub, our company offers unique advantages such as access to cutting-edge technologies and a supportive team dedicated to your success.

hackajob

Contact Details:

hackajob Recruitment Team

StudySmarter Expert Advice🤫

We think this is how you could land Real-Time Stream Processing Engineer (Flink & Kafka)

Tip Number 1

Network like a pro! Reach out to folks in the industry, attend meetups, and connect with people on LinkedIn. You never know who might have the inside scoop on job openings or can refer you directly.

Tip Number 2

Show off your skills! Create a portfolio showcasing your projects, especially those involving Apache Flink and Kafka. This gives potential employers a taste of what you can do and sets you apart from the crowd.

Tip Number 3

Prepare for technical interviews by brushing up on your Java and Spring knowledge. Practice coding challenges and system design questions that are relevant to stream processing. We want you to feel confident when it’s showtime!

Tip Number 4

Don’t forget to apply through our website! It’s the best way to ensure your application gets seen. Plus, we love seeing candidates who take the initiative to engage with us directly.

We think you need these skills to ace Real-Time Stream Processing Engineer (Flink & Kafka)

Apache Flink
Kafka Streams
Java
Spring
Stream Processing
AWS Systems
System Design

Some tips for your application 🫡

Tailor Your CV:Make sure your CV highlights your experience with Apache Flink, Kafka Streams, and Java. We want to see how your skills align with the role, so don’t be shy about showcasing relevant projects!

Craft a Compelling Cover Letter:Your cover letter is your chance to shine! Tell us why you’re passionate about stream processing and how your background makes you the perfect fit for our team. Keep it engaging and personal.

Showcase Your Problem-Solving Skills:In your application, include examples of how you've tackled complex distributed systems in the past. We love seeing how you approach challenges and come up with innovative solutions!

Apply Through Our Website:We encourage you to apply directly through our website. It’s the best way for us to receive your application and ensures you don’t miss out on any important updates from us!

How to prepare for a job interview at hackajob

Know Your Tech Inside Out

Make sure you brush up on your knowledge of Apache Flink and Kafka Streams. Be ready to discuss how you've used these technologies in past projects, as well as any challenges you faced and how you overcame them.

Showcase Your System Design Skills

Prepare to talk about your experience in designing and architecting complex distributed systems. Think of specific examples where you’ve implemented solutions that improved performance or scalability, and be ready to explain your thought process.

Demonstrate Your Java and Spring Expertise

Since the role requires a strong background in Java and Spring, be prepared to answer technical questions or even solve coding problems on the spot. Practise common algorithms and design patterns that are relevant to stream processing.

Engage with Product Engineering Insights

Understand the role of Product Engineers and how your work will assist them. Be ready to discuss how you can contribute to tooling and collaboration, showing that you’re not just a techie but also a team player who values cross-functional work.